GREEN v. HEARD MOTOR CO.

No. 7688.

53 So.2d 700 (1951)

GREEN v. HEARD MOTOR CO., Inc. et al.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ana. Second Circuit.

June 29, 1951.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Bolin, Lowe & Fish, Minden, for appellant.

Cook, Clark & Egan, Shreveport, for appellee.


HARDY, Judge.

This is an action for compensation instituted by the widow of a deceased employee of defendant, Heard Motor Company, Inc., in her own right and on behalf of her minor son. The employer's insurer, Maryland Casualty Company, is joined as a party defendant. Following a plea of vagueness and filing of a supplemental and amended petition, defendant interposed exceptions of no cause and no right of action.
